BSLogWindow 2.0.0

BSLogWindow 2.0.0

FreeBaiShun维护。



  • 作者:
  • FreeBaiShun

BSLogWindow

  1. 是否遇到过这样的情况,后台开发同事总是询问当前的账号userid、token问题。总是询问入参出参问题。那么这个工具就可以用起来了,让他们自己去看吧!
  2. 一个方便离线查看日志的工具
  3. 可以控制打印到屏幕、控制台,或者两者都打印
  4. 点击屏幕上的日志按钮来控制显示和隐藏屏幕上的日志信息
  5. 长按日志按钮可以清空屏幕上的日志信息

效果

image

用法

  1. pod 'BSLogWindow'
  2. 代码示例
//AppDelegate.m
#ifdef DEBUG // 开发
#define BSLogWindowShow 1

#else // 生产
#define BSLogWindowShow 0

#endif

-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
//BSLogWindow(控制显示)
[BSLogWindow showWindow:BSLogWindowShow];
return YES;
}

//打印数据
[BSLogWindow BSLog:@"test" type:BSLogTypeAll];//控制台和屏幕都要打印
[BSLogWindow BSLog:@"test" type:BSLogTypeConsole];//只在控制台打印
[BSLogWindow BSLog:@"test" type:BSLogTypeScreen];//只在屏幕打印